Japanese Matcha Tea Ceremony and Kimono Experience in Hanayaka
Overview
This is an activity where you can experience Japanese traditional culture at the same time. Customers arrive at the store and choose their favorite kimono or yukata to dress up. After styling your hair, enter the tea room and begin your tea ceremony experience. After completing the experience, you can go to Sensoji Temple and take a walk. And returned to the store before 5pm to change your clothes and finished.
